Python Qustion

Write a program that uses the keys(), values(), and/or items() dict methods to find statistics about the student_grades dictionary. Find the following:

Print the name and grade percentage of the student with the highest total of points

Find the average score of each assignment.

Find and apply a curve to each student's total score, such that the best student has 100% of the total points.

student_grades = {
'Andrew': [56, 79, 90, 22, 50],
'Colin': [88, 62, 68, 75, 78],
'Alan': [95, 88, 92, 85, 85],
'Mary': [76, 88, 85, 82, 90],
'Tricia': [99, 92, 95, 89, 99]
